Automated Correction for Trace Tables in a CS1 Course
Fernando Teubl,
Francisco Zampirolli
Abstract:This work presents a remote, asynchronous, parametric, and automatically corrected evaluation based on the Trace Table method for an introductory programming course. Moodle was used as the learning platform, VPL as the evaluation module/interface, and MCTest as the test generator. The Trace Table method allows for the analysis of students’ knowledge in pseudocode, without relying on any specific programming language.
